Alejandro Garnacho is feeling the pressure of Jamie Gittens’ improving form, but he’s done himself a big favour tonight with an important goal.
The winger raced forward on the counter and tried to pick out Estevao. The pass was cut out, but the loose ball fell to Garnacho again, and he hit a great low shot on his left foot, across the keeper low into the corner to equalise the game.
It was a great moment for him – his first Chelsea goal in the Champions League. But it comes in immensely frustrating circumstances as the Blues drop points in a game where they desperately needed three. Enzo Maresca’s decision to bring on Garnacho was justified though – and the left winger will surely stay in his first team plans going forward.

This defeat puts Chelsea in a tricky position in terms of their Champions League hopes. The top 8 was on the cards if they could win tonight – now they need results against the likes of Barcelona if they want to avoid that playoff later in the season.
We’re now at the half way point of the league phase, and we’ve had two wins, a draw and a defeat. This was our most winnable game in many ways, and we fear these two points will haunt us come January.
Once again, just as there’s the potential to answer come questions from this team, their mentality lets them down.
The Blues had taken the lead in this game through Estevao Willian – although their subsequent bad defending meant that didn’t last long.
